- Synopsis
- Satana has lost her soul to a pack of nerds in a game of chance and turns to Deadpool for help. When the geek squad turns out to be demonic denizens in disguise looking to improve their position in hell by hooking up with the devil's daughter, Deadpool offers an ingenious solution--marry him instead.

- Synopsis
- Aaron Stack, Machine Man turned insurance rep, shows up at Deadpool's pad looking to collect monetary compensation for all of the millions of dollars in damage DP has cost Delmar Insurance during his many adventures. Machine Man offers to wipe 'Pool's slate clean if he will help save a room full of insurance execs from the manipulative machinations of the Puppet Master.

- Synopsis
- The Thing is ringside as a guest announcer for an Unlimited Class Wrestling Federation bout when he discovers that Deadpool has joined the league as a wrestling manager. Both heroes are horrified when they learn that even in the UCWF, wrestling is fake. The script gets flipped, however, when an alien champion shows up to wrestle the best earth has to offer and the Thing and DP form a tag team to take on Maximum Intensity.

- Synopsis
- Dr. Curtis Nolan searches the ruins of Asgard looking for valuable loot but finds that Deadpool has arrived first with much the same idea. DP accidentally sets off an alarm, bringing Thor running to repel the intruders. As Thor verily smites 'Pool, Curtis finds an amulet that is the mystic prison of the powerful and deadly Den Vakre who desires nothing more than to possess the homely nerd and cause a little chaos. Since Vakre is a pretty hot babe, the doctor readily agrees, causing loads of trouble for our heroes.
